The effect on cold ions of ionospheric origin of the low-frequency, large-amplitude electric field fluctuations (LEF) observed by Viking on auroral latitude magnetic field lines is calculated directly with the use of an observed time series of the electric field. The perpendicular acceleration of O+ ions is found to be more effective than that of photons. Energies in keV and tens of keV ranges are reached within a few tens of seconds by both O+ and H+ ions, but O+ ions obtain higher energies. Outflow velocities along the field line of hundreds of kilometers per second are generally acquired. Similar results can be found with a completely random variation of the electric field, but with less favoring of O+ ions over protons. The amplitude dependence of the perpendicular acceleration is roughly quadratic. The efficiency of LEF in bringing ionospheric ions of all kinds, but particularly heavier ions, into the magnetosphere is very high.
